Software Developer
Full Stack EngineerOn behalf of our client, the largest systemic bank in Greece and a key player in the country’s financial ecosystem, we are seeking an experienced Software Developer to join its team of professionals in Athens.
A day in the life of a Software Developer
You will be joining a newly formed Systems Innovation team with a clear 3–5 year roadmap to modernize and migrate legacy platforms to contemporary, scalable architectures using cutting-edge technologies.
Responsibilities
- Design, build, and maintain software in the Loan Origination area (mostly BPM systems)
- Develop and integrate applications using modern APIs and system architectures
- Monitor and support loan origination workflows (both in-house and vendor-supplied)Collaborate with Business Analysts to translate requirements into working solutions
- Participate in large-scale digital transformation initiatives
- Own the architecture and documentation of your systems
- Apply code reviews and promote clean, secure, and efficient code
- Mentor junior team members and promote best practices
What you will need
- Strong hands-on experience with Java
- Solid understanding of BPM systems – ideally Appian or similar (e.g. Camunda, jBPM)
- Familiarity with low-code platforms and workflow automation
- Good knowledge of REST APIs, databases, and microservices architecture
- A mindset for clean code, collaboration, and continuous learning
What's in it for you
A competitive compensation package including a performance-based bonus, private health insurance, and meal vouchers. You’ll also benefit from continuous learning opportunities, access to modern tools and technologies, and the chance to grow within a stable yet innovation-driven environment.
Stavros Balios
Associate Consultant
REFERENCE: job0000260301